Heat Treatment and Cold Forming Processes for Nickel-Based Alloy Incoloy 800 Fasteners
author: www.qishine.com
2025-06-07
1. Solution Treatment: 1100°C × 1h Water Quench (Full Austenitization + Stress Relief)
Process Principle
- Full Austenitization: Heating to 1100°C (above γ' phase complete dissolution temperature of 1050°C) to dissolve carbides (e.g., M₂₃C₆) and γ' phase (Ni₃(Al,Ti)), achieving homogeneous single-phase austenitic microstructure.

- Rapid Water Quenching: Suppresses secondary phase precipitation during cooling, retaining supersaturated solid solution for subsequent age hardening.
Incoloy 800 Fasteners Key Parameter Controls
| Parameter | Technical Requirements | Data Support |
| Heating Rate | ≤220°C/h (to prevent thermal stress cracking) | AMS 2750D Class 4 furnace requirements |
| Soaking Time | 1h (for bars ≤25mm diameter) → +0.5h per 25mm increment (ensuring complete core phase transformation) | ASTM B408 Annex A1 |
| Quench Delay | <10 sec (prevents grain boundary carbide precipitation) | 30% reduction in intergranular corrosion rate (ASTM G28) |
| Grain Size | ASTM 5-7 (grain size 50-90μm). Oversized grains reduce fatigue strength (ΔKth↓) | SEM-EBSD analysis (Fig. 1) |
Microstructure Validation:
- Metallography (ASTM E112): No undissolved carbides (verified at 500× optical microscopy).
- XRD: Austenite phase content >99.5% (Cu-Kα radiation, FWHM <0.5°).

2. Cold Forming: Multi-Station Cold Heading + Thread Rolling
2.1 Cold Heading (Bolt Head Forming)
- Material Preparation:
- Phosphating + soaping coating (3-5g/m²), friction coefficient μ≤0.05 (ISO 6892).
- Cold-drawn bar hardness: HRB 75-85 (ensures formability without cracking).

- Process Parameters:
| Stage | Reduction | Tool Material | Lubricant |
| Cutting | - | SKD11 (HRC 60-62) | Graphite grease (40wt.%) |
| Pre-forming | 20-30% area reduction | YG8 carbide | Extreme pressure additive (1% S+P) |
| Finish heading | ≤50% total reduction | Tungsten steel CD650 (HV 1500) | Nano-MoS₂ coating (2μm) |
- Flow Line Integrity Verification:
- Macro-etching (ASTM E340): Continuous flow lines in head, no folds at thread transition (Fig. 2).
- FEM simulation (Deform-3D): PEEQ ≤1.2, no localized overstrain.

2.2 Incoloy 800 Fasteners Thread Rolling (Chip-less Forming)
- Roller Design:
- Material: Powdered high-speed steel ASP2060 (HRC 64-66).
- Profile angle: 60°±15′ (per ASME B1.1 Unified Thread Standard).
- Rolling speed: 25-35 RPM (linear velocity 1.2-1.7 m/min).

- Critical Controls:
- Rolling force: \( F = 0.8 \times \sigma_{0.2} \times A \) (σ₀.₂=450 MPa, A=thread root cross-section area).
- Residual stress: -350 to -500 MPa surface compressive stress (XRD), improving fatigue life by 20%+.

- Defect Prevention:
- Thread root cracks: Pre-rolling hardness ≤HRB 90 + 100% magnetic particle inspection (ASTM E1444).
- Pitch deviation: 3-roller machines maintain <0.02mm/25mm error (ISO 965-1 Grade 4h).

3. Age Hardening: 720°C × 16h (γ' Phase Precipitation Control)
3.1 Precipitation Kinetics
- γ' phase (Ni₃(Al,Ti)):
- Size distribution: 10-30 nm (TEM bright-field imaging, Fig. 3), number density ~1×10²²/m³.
- Strengthening contribution: Δσ = \( M \times G \times b \times \sqrt{N \times d} \) (M=3.06, G=78 GPa, b=0.25 nm) ≈300 MPa.

3.2 Process Window Optimization
| Parameter | Lower Limit | Nominal | Upper Limit | Failure Mode |
| Temperature | 700°C (incomplete precipitation) | 720°C | 750°C (over-coarsening) | Hardness |
| Time | 8h (suboptimal hardness) | 16h | 24h (σ phase risk) | Impact energy <40J (ASTM E23) |
Performance Data:
- Hardness gradient: ≤2 HRC difference surface-to-core (HV0.3, 300gf load).
- Elevated temperature stress rupture (800°C/200MPa): 1200h (aged) vs 600h (solution-treated) (ASTM E139).

3.3 Dual-Stage Aging (Optional):
1) Primary: 650°C×8h → High-density nano γ' (5-10 nm).
2) Secondary: 750°C×2h → Optimized γ' size (20-30 nm) for strength-toughness balance.
- Result: 15% fatigue limit improvement (R=-1, 10⁷ cycles, ISO 1099).

4. Quality Control Checkpoints
| Process Step | Inspection Method | Acceptance Criteria | Equipment Example |
| Grain size | EBSD | ASTM 5-7, misorientation <15° | Zeiss Sigma 300 SEM |
| Flow line defects | Ultrasonic Testing (UT) | Flaws <0.5mm equivalent | Olympus Omniscan MX2 |
| γ' phase size | TEM | 10-30 nm, uniform distribution | JEOL JEM-2100F |
5. Engineering Performance Comparison
- Conventional Process (Solution-treated only):
- Hardness HRB 85-90, creep rate at 600°C: 5×10⁻⁸ s⁻¹ (ASTM E139).
- Optimized Process (Solution + Cold Work + Aging):
- Hardness HRC 28, creep rate reduced to 2×10⁻⁹ s⁻¹, bolt preload retention >90% (1000h test).

Conclusions
Incoloy 800 fastener performance critically depends on precise control of the process chain:
1) 1100°C solution treatment establishes γ' phase regulation baseline (must prevent carbide precipitation).
2) 50% cold work introduces dislocations for aging but requires crack risk mitigation.
3) 720°C×16h aging achieves optimal γ' size/distribution, with HRC 25-30 being the strength-toughness "sweet spot".
